The story of Mamma Mia begins with a young girl preparing for her wedding day. She decides that after years of not knowing who her father is she would like to right the wrong and invite the three possible men to the island where she is getting married, catapulting them back in to her mother’s life; madness ensues raising eyebrows and the roof alike with drama, hilarity and a collection of the greatest songs of our lifetime.

The Open Air Theatre Regents Park commences with its celebrated summer season of classic plays and musical production. This year opens with Arthur Miller’s The Crucible, and theatre tickets are available to buy now.

Arthur Miller’s renowned play The Crucible is set in Salem Massachusetts in the year of 1692, an era plagued with puritanical religion and accusations of witchcraft. Three girls of the town are hailed with such accusations after rumours are spread and the locals, already battling their petty rivalries, turn hearsay and suspicion into hard evidence. As the girls stand up against the court the town is split into those who want truth and those who seek mindless, so called ‘justice’. The play is based on a period of persecution and communal hysteria in the 1950s, when Senator J R McCarthy conducted his unscrupulous and vigorous investigations.

The cast of The Crucible includes Patrick O’Kane, Emily Taaffe, Emma Cunniffe, Oliver For-Davies, Charlie Cameron, Lucy May Barker, Philip Cumbus, Susan Engel, Anni Domingo, Christopher Fulford, Christopher Hunter, Patrick Godfrey, Bettrys Jones, Geoff Leesley, Paul Kemp, Alexandra Mathie, Ellie Paskell, Gary Milner and Malcolm Rogers.

Timothy Sheader directs the production, with design from Jon Bausor, sound by Nick Powell and Fergus O’Hare, lighting by Paul Keogan and movement by Liam Steel.

Following The Crucible in the summer season is Shakespeare’s The Comedy of Errors and Macbeth, and the musical Into The Woods.
